Peter McQuillan has finished up a patch for Slim Device's SqueezeCenter (formally SlimServer) that adds WavPack support. This has not made it into the nightly builds yet, but it is certainly in a usable form (I have been testing it for a couple weeks now on both Windows and Ubuntu Linux). It supports virtually all WavPack files (including legacy files and 24/96) and handles all the tagging formats (even the new cover art tag). Because it utilizes the regular CLI decoder it also plays with the correction files in hybrid mode if they are present.

If you're using Linux then it's pretty trivial to try it out; just download the latest SqueezeCenter from SVN and apply the patch. On Windows it's more difficult because you have to install a Perl interpreter, but it's still doable. Also note that on Windows you must use the wvunpack.exe that's in the patch because it has a little mod that allows it to be syntactically identical to the Linux version (it ignores -o on the command line).

WavPack has made it into SVN on the Slim Devices site, which means it appears in the nightly builds available here:

http://www.slimdevices.com/downloads/nightly/latest/7.0/

Now Windows users can try it easily without having to install a Perl interpreter. I haven't had a chance to test it yet, but Peter tells me it works great.

BTW, this now has support for WavPack images with external cue sheets using the --skip and --until commands that I added in 4.41. Good stuff! smile.gif

It wasn't mentioned before, but this support also handles ReplayGain information, whether stored in the APEv2 tags or in the cuesheet. Very cool! smile.gif
